Weaving's ConciergeMickalene Thomas stands as a pivotal figure in 21st-century contemporary art, captivating audiences with her unique blend of painting, collage, photography, and immersive installations. Her work is not merely visual; it resonates deeply with themes of race, gender, and self-perception, challenging traditional notions of beauty and celebrity.
This monograph provides a sweeping survey of Thomas's extraordinary career, showcasing how her influences—from the rich history of 19th-century painting to the vibrancy of popular culture—inform her artistic narrative. Each piece invites viewers to engage with complex questions surrounding aspiration and identity.
In addition to highlighting her artistic evolution, the book coincides with the launch of Thomas's first global exhibition, "Beyond the Pleasure Principle." This exhibition is set to take place across major galleries in New York, London, Paris, and Hong Kong, further underscoring her significant role in today’s art landscape.
Through this publication, readers are granted an intimate glimpse into the mind of a transformative artist whose work continues to inspire and provoke thought about the intersection of art and social discourse.
